Show About the author William C. Gibson Mr. Gibson is a co-inventor and Manager of the ULTRALOW NOx™ Technology Division of IT-McGill PCS. His job responsibilities include the research, design, development and applications of ULTRA LOW NOX™ technology. All research and testing is conducted at the international ITMcGill PCS Research Facility located in Tulsa, Oklahoma. Mr. Gibson has been directly involved in the design, computer modeling and field testing of direct fired heaters and boilers for the past 16 years. He has a B.S. degree in Aeronautics Mathematics from Miami University of Ohio and a B.S. degree (with honors) in Mechanical Engineering from Michigan State University.
